Brushing Green

     Today we brushed our greens before we mowed them.  Brushing helps stand the leaf blade up so the mower can cut it.  The bentgrass on our greens is Penncross Creeping Bentgrass it is notorious for growing horizontally.  We will continue this practice to help get all of these lateral leaf blades cut.  This will dramatically improve ball roll on our greens.
